Solution Overview
Problem
Current web-based gift registry systems lack intuitive graphical user interfaces and methods for creating and managing gift registries, particularly in retail environments, which can lead to user confusion and incomplete or unattractive registry presentations.
Innovation Solution
A graphical user interface for creating and managing gift registries that includes features such as customizable themes, recommended products, and a method for calculating recommended gift counts based on event type and guest number, along with print preview functionality for brick-and-mortar store integration.
Engineering Contradictions & Design Principles
Engineering Contradiction Analysis
1Ease of operation
If a traditional web-based gift registry interface is used, then basic product listing is achieved, but user interaction and visual appeal are insufficient
Solution Approach 1:
The registry interface is segmented into distinct visual regions: a main message region at the top, followed by multiple item information sub-regions arranged in a grid layout. Each sub-region contains specific product details (image, name, price, recommendations), creating an organized and intuitive visual structure that improves user interaction without excessive complexity.
Solution Approach 2:
The interface transitions from traditional linear web listings to a two-dimensional grid layout of item information sub-regions. This dimensional change allows multiple products to be displayed simultaneously in an organized manner, enhancing visual appeal and ease of browsing while maintaining clear information hierarchy.
2Productivity
If gift registry is created without automated calculations, then manual control is maintained, but gift distribution and completeness are insufficient
Solution Approach 1:
The system performs preliminary calculations to determine the recommended number of gifts based on event type and guest count before the user begins building the registry. This automated guidance helps users understand the expected scope and distribution of gifts, improving registry completion without requiring manual calculation of each parameter.
Solution Approach 2:
The interface provides feedback by displaying recommended gift counts and price range distributions, allowing users to compare their current registry progress against these recommendations. This feedback mechanism guides users in creating more complete and balanced registries while maintaining manual control over final selections.
3Adaptability or versatility
If print functionality is added for brick and mortar stores, then in-store utility is improved, but interface complexity increases
Solution Approach 1:
The print registry control serves multiple functions: it provides print preview capability, allows selection of specific items for printing, and prepares data for in-store use. This multi-functional control consolidates several needs into a single interface element, improving store integration while minimizing the increase in overall interface complexity.

In one embodiment, a graphical user interface presents a gift registry having a number of registered products available to purchase through a retailer. The graphical user interface may present a view of information regarding registered products including an image, a description, and a price associated with each registered product. A recommended product may be presented in relation to a registered product, the recommended product selected as being complementary to the registered product. The recommended product information presented may include a product image, a product description and a product selection control.
